Iam relocating to Germany, Cologne area to be precise, and wanted to know if it would be fairly straightforward to receive UK channels there,:) BBC etc, with a freesat box bought here, the relevant dish and a UK postcode.

An 80 cm dish will be big enough in Cologne for the time being.

Quite what will happen in the next couple of years once the new satellites start coming on line is anyones guess.

no problem to receive the Freesat channels in or near Cologne.
Any non-Freesat receiver will do and a UK postcode is not required unless you want to receive local information automatically.

But if he uses a Freesat Receiver - for the benefit of the 7 day EPG and maybe PVR facilities - he will need to enter a Postcode. Which is a minor issue anyway.



non-Freesat boxes generally only have Now & Next . Even I, the arch luddite, have finally moved on from generic boxes for 28E (Still use them extensively for other Satellites, though)!
